  • Learn how-to gold leaf. www.sflocalcolo... Master craftsman Chris Schneider of SF Local Color teaches you how to properly apply Gold Leaf on a beautiful San Francisco Victorian home. Local Color is a San Francisco classic. Dubbed one of the "Mothers of the Movement" in the Color Movement that transformed SF's Victorians into the lovely Painted Ladies that they are now and saved hundreds from the wrecking ball.

    The stuff one can buy at Walmart is actually METAL leaf - which is FAKE gold, and the same goes for the liquid gold or gold paint. REAL 24kt or 23.75 kt is going for around 70-80 bucks per book for loose leaf, a bit more for patent leaf, which the gilder is using. If you use metal leaf, even if it is coloured, it has to be finished w/a protective layer of finish or it will tarnish. There is a gilder's society for anyone interested in developing knowledge and skill.

      When gilding the surface must be nonporous. Therefore you must seal the concrete. I suggest a urethane or epoxy. After sealing and smoothing, you can easily gild concrete using an appropriate gilding adhesive.

    Ginger that is absolutely false. There is no such thing as a paint that will look anywhere near as good as leaf. "Gold paint" is made of brass and will tarnish. If you use that on the exterior of a house it will turn dark brown or green and look horrible. There is NO substitute for gold leaf outdoors.
